The Bucharest Tribunal has rejected the appeals of the ANPC in several cases, increasing to seven the number of lawsuits won by banks regarding annuities, despite the fines imposed in 2023. The courts considered that the ANPC's accusations regarding misleading practices are unfounded, thus maintaining the banks' advantage. The ANPC argues that the annuity system harms consumers, but the courts have dismissed these arguments, emphasizing that reimbursement in annuities is legal. The sanctioned banks include major financial institutions in Romania, which continue to contest the ANPC's sanctions.
